Solutions for "with reference to crossword clue" by Letter Count

2 Letters

RE: A common abbreviation for 'regarding' or 'with reference to', frequently used in crosswords. It comes from the Latin word 'res', meaning 'thing' or 'affair'.

4 Letters

ASTO: While often written as two words, 'as to' (meaning 'with reference to' or 'concerning') is sometimes seen combined in crosswords to fit a four-letter slot. It's a slightly more formal expression.

5 Letters

ABOUT: A direct and very common synonym for 'with reference to', indicating the topic, subject, or central point of discussion. This is a very frequent answer for this type of clue.

9 Letters

REGARDING: A more formal synonym often interchangeable with 'with reference to', indicating relation to a particular matter or subject. It’s frequently used in formal correspondence or reports.

10 Letters

CONCERNING: Another formal synonym, meaning 'about' or 'with reference to', often used for specifying a topic or point of interest. It conveys a similar meaning to 'regarding'.

More About "with reference to crossword clue"

"With reference to" is a common phrase encountered in both everyday language and, consequently, in crossword puzzles. Essentially, it serves as a polite or formal way of introducing the topic or subject of discussion. In crosswords, clues using this phrase are typically direct definitions, asking for a synonym that conveys the same meaning of 'about' or 'regarding'. The challenge often lies in figuring out the exact word length the setter is looking for, as many synonyms exist, ranging from short abbreviations to longer, more formal terms.

The beauty of this clue type in crosswords is its versatility. A setter might use it to prompt a very short, common abbreviation like 'RE', which is derived from Latin and signifies 'in the matter of'. Alternatively, they could be looking for a longer, more descriptive word like 'CONCERNING' or 'REGARDING'. Understanding the nuances of these synonyms and their typical word lengths is key to solving such clues efficiently and accurately, ensuring you don't waste time trying to fit a long word into a short slot, or vice versa.
